返回

从容解惑:如何写出无需耗费时间分析的日志文件

闲谈

日志文件:深入洞察应用程序运行的关键

日志文件是您应用程序中信息的重要来源,可以帮助您在需要时轻松排除故障,并密切关注应用程序的运行状况。其中可能包含有关错误、警告、信息和调试消息的信息。因此,如果您没有正确编写日志文件,则可能会给您带来不必要的麻烦,甚至可能会错过一些严重的问题。

常见的日志文件编写误区

  1. 错误消息太过于简单或模糊不清 :有些日志文件只会在错误发生时记录简单的错误消息,例如“发生错误”或“操作失败”。这样的错误消息不仅不能帮助您诊断问题,反而会给您带来更多困扰。

  2. 日志信息不完整 :有些日志文件可能会包含一些信息,但并不足够帮助您诊断问题。例如,日志文件可能会记录“应用程序已崩溃”,但没有提供任何其他详细信息,例如导致应用程序崩溃的原因或应用程序崩溃时正在执行什么操作。

  3. 日志文件难以阅读 :有些日志文件可能包含大量的信息,但这些信息却很难阅读和理解。例如,日志文件可能包含大量的技术术语或缩写,这可能会让您难以理解日志文件中的信息。

  4. 日志文件不安全 :有些日志文件可能包含敏感信息,例如用户数据或密码。如果这些信息泄露,可能会给您带来安全风险。

  5. 日志文件记录过多或过少的信息 :有些日志文件可能会记录过多的信息,这可能会使日志文件变得难以阅读和理解。而有些日志文件可能记录的信息太少,这可能会让您难以诊断问题。

编写可节省您时间的日志文件

为了避免上述常见的错误,您需要遵循以下几点建议来编写可节省您时间的日志文件:

  1. 确保错误消息是详细和有意义的 :错误消息应该清晰地错误的原因,并提供有关如何解决错误的信息。例如,您可以使用“数据库连接失败”作为错误消息,并提供有关如何重新建立数据库连接的信息。

  2. 在日志文件中包含足够的信息 :日志文件中应该包含足够的信息来帮助您诊断问题。例如,您可以记录错误发生的时间、错误的类型、错误发生的位置以及导致错误的任何其他信息。

  3. 让日志文件易于阅读 :日志文件应该易于阅读和理解。您可以使用清晰和简洁的语言,并避免使用技术术语或缩写。

  4. 确保日志文件是安全的 :日志文件应该包含敏感信息,例如用户数据或密码。您可以使用加密或其他安全措施来保护这些信息。

  5. 记录适量的信息 :日志文件中应该记录适量的信息。您可以根据您的应用程序的需要来调整日志记录的级别。例如,您可以记录所有错误消息,但只记录重要的警告和信息消息。

  6. 使用日志记录框架 :您可以使用日志记录框架来帮助您编写日志文件。日志记录框架可以帮助您轻松地记录日志消息,并提供各种各样的功能来帮助您管理日志文件。

  7. 定期检查日志文件 :您应该定期检查日志文件以查找任何潜在的问题。您可以使用日志分析工具来帮助您分析日志文件并查找任何异常情况。

  8. 将日志文件备份到安全的位置 :您应该将日志文件备份到安全的位置,以防万一日志文件丢失或损坏。